Description

The story behind this fragrance

Forum Man opens with a bright, herbal snap—basil and wild lavender cut through citrus brightness, lime and bergamot lending a crisp green energy before mandarin's warmth creeps in. The heart softens into floral leather, carnation and violet blooming against a woody cedar backbone, geranium adding a peppery green thread. As it settles, amber and labdanum wrap everything in a resinous, slightly smoky warmth, musk grounding the base in skin-close softness and patchouli's earthy undertone lingering long after the initial brightness fades.
